  • Help stop squeaks and wear on your Lawn Mowers front end and also improve ease of steering all for about $6 and 10 minutes of your time. Step by Step Installation and project review for Cub Cadet, John Deere, Craftsman, Troy-Bilt, Husqvarna etc riding lawn mowers
